DNA Damage Response and Genome Instability

The research program is strongly aligned with DNA damage response biology, with trials in tumors characterized by ATM deficiency and related vulnerabilities in genomic instability.

  • ATM-negative cancers
  • Genomic repair pathways
  • Targeted oncology

These studies place emphasis on biologically defined cancer subsets where defects in DNA repair may shape therapeutic sensitivity.

Gynecologic Oncology

Artios Pharma Limited also investigates high-grade serous ovarian carcinoma, primary peritoneal carcinoma, and fallopian tube carcinoma, with attention to platinum-resistant disease.

  • Ovarian cancer
  • Primary peritoneal cancer
  • Fallopian tube cancer

This reflects a therapeutic focus on gynecologic cancers that remain challenging after standard platinum-based treatment.

Breast Cancer and BRCA-Associated Disease

The sponsor’s portfolio includes HER2-negative locally advanced or metastatic breast cancer with gBRCA mutation, linking its research to inherited susceptibility and homologous recombination-related tumor biology.

  • HER2-negative breast cancer
  • gBRCA-mutated disease
  • Homologous recombination deficiency

These studies position breast oncology within a broader precision-medicine program spanning advanced solid tumors.
